वेब कॅप्चर आणि रूपांतरित करण्यासाठी साधने

GrabzIt सह रेंडर केलेल्या HTML API वर URLप्रस्तुत केलेल्या HTML API वर URL

ब्राउझरच्या वेळी URL किंवा HTML स्निपेट कार्यान्वित करण्यासाठी GrabzIt चे प्रस्तुत HTML HTML वापरा आणि पुढील प्रक्रियेसाठी प्रक्रिया केलेल्या HTML आपल्या कोडवर परत करा.

जावास्क्रिप्ट कार्यान्वित झाल्यानंतर आपल्याला वेबपृष्ठाचा निकाल लागण्याची आवश्यकता आहे का? कदाचित आपण वेब स्क्रॅप करण्यासाठी अ‍ॅप लिहिले आहे आणि ब्राउझरद्वारे निर्मीत केलेले प्रस्तुत HTML परत करण्याची आवश्यकता आहे. त्याऐवजी वेब पृष्ठाच्या कच्च्या HTML पेक्षा. मग हे आपल्यासाठी एपीआय आहे!

तथापि हे एपीआय देखील नवीन आहे आणि सध्या बीटा चाचणी चालू आहे. म्हणून आपल्याकडे काही समस्या किंवा सूचना असल्यास कृपया अजिबात संकोच करू नका आमच्याशी संपर्क. आपण आमच्यामध्ये हे वैशिष्ट्य देखील वापरून पाहू शकता स्क्रीनशॉट साधन आपल्याला कोणताही कोड न लिहिता HTML प्रस्तुत करण्यास अनुमती देते.

आमचे एपीएल कोणत्याही URL ला प्रस्तुत केलेल्या एचटीएमएलमध्ये कसे रूपांतरित करते ते पाहण्यासाठी खालील डेमोचा प्रयत्न करा फक्त एका वेब पृष्ठाची URL प्रविष्ट करा आणि ग्रॅबझिट क्लिक करा. त्यानंतर एकदा त्या वेब पृष्ठावरील प्रस्तुत HTML असलेली HTML फाइल स्वयंचलितपणे डाउनलोड केली जाईल.

प्रस्तुत केलेली HTML API

GrabzIt च्या सर्व API प्रमाणे, प्रस्तुत केलेल्या HTML API नऊ प्रोग्रामिंग भाषांचे समर्थन करते. कोड स्निपेट आणि आपल्या अ‍ॅपमध्ये त्याची अंमलबजावणी कशी करावी यासाठी सूचना पाहण्यासाठी फक्त खालील पर्यायांमधून आवश्यक भाषा निवडा.

GrabzIt ची ASP.NET लायब्ररी कोणत्याही .NET भाषेसह सुसंगत असली तरी खाली दिलेला उदाहरण कोड C # वापरून HTML प्रस्तुत करण्यासाठी आमचे API वापरणे किती सोपे आहे हे दर्शविते. फक्त पीडीएफ तयार करणे प्रारंभ करण्यासाठी एएसपी.नेट लायब्ररी डाउनलोड करा, आपल्या मिळवा की आणि गुपित आणि नंतर डेमो वापरा आत समाविष्ट. मग पहा एएसपी.नेटसाठी एपीआय द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

GrabzItClient grabzIt = new G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ret");
grabzIt.URLToRenderedHTML("https://www.bbc.com/"); 
grabzIt.SaveTo("result.html");

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ता HTMLOptions वर्ग इतर रूपांतरण पद्धती प्रमाणेच.

आमचे रेंडर केलेले HTML जावा लायब्ररी वापरणे किती सोपे आहे हे खाली दिलेला उदाहरण कोड दर्शवितो. प्रस्तुत केवळ HTML तयार करणे प्रारंभ करण्यासाठी जावा ग्रंथालय डाउनलोड करा, आपल्या मिळवा की आणि गुपित आणि नंतर डेमो वापरा आत समाविष्ट. मग पहा जावा साठी API द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

GrabzItClient grabzIt = new G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ret");
grabzIt.URLToRenderedHTML("https://www.bbc.com/"); 
grabzIt.SaveTo("result.html");

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ता HTMLOptions वर्ग इतर रूपांतरण पद्धती प्रमाणेच.

जावास्क्रिप्टचा वापर करुन URL ला HTML मध्ये रूपांतरित करण्यासाठी आमचे API वापरणे किती सोपे आहे हे खालील उदाहरण कोड दर्शविते. प्रस्तुत HTML डाउनलोड तयार करणे प्रारंभ करण्यासाठी ग्रॅबझिटची जावास्क्रिप्ट लायब्ररी. मग आपले मिळवा की आणि गुपित, डोमेन जोडा आपल्याला जावास्क्रिप्ट चालू करायचा आहे आणि नंतर हे पहा जावास्क्रिप्टसाठी API द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

<script src="https://cdn.jsdelivr.net/npm/@grabzit/js@3.4.8/grabzit.min.js"></script>
<script>
GrabzIt("Sign in to view your Application Key").ConvertURL("https://www.bbc.com/",
{"format": "html"}).Create();
</script>

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ता पर्याय इतर स्वरूपनांसाठी उपलब्ध असलेल्या प्रमाणेच मालमत्ता.

खाली दिलेला कोड कोड दाखवतो की आमचे एपीआय नोड.जेएस वापरून एचडीएमएल रूपांतरणात URL सादर करण्यासाठी किती सोपे आहे. फक्त पीडीएफ तयार करणे प्रारंभ करण्यासाठी नोड.जेएस पॅकेज डाउनलोड करा, आपल्या मिळवा की आणि गुपित आणि नंतर डेमो वापरा आत समाविष्ट. मग पहा Node.js साठी API द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

var grabzit = require('grabzit');

var client = new grabzit("Sign in to view your Application Key", "Sign in to view your Application Secret");
client.url_to_rendered_html("https://www.bbc.com/");
client.save_to("result.html", function (error, id){
    if (error != null){
        throw error;
    }
});

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ता पर्याय इतर रूपांतरण पद्धती प्रमाणेच मालमत्ता.

पर्लचा वापर करुन यूआरएलच्या URL मध्ये रूपांतरित करण्यासाठी आमचे API वापरणे किती सोपे आहे हे खालील उदाहरण कोड दर्शविते. प्रस्तुत केवळ HTML तयार करणे प्रारंभ करण्यासाठी पर्ल लायब्ररी डाउनलोड करा, आपल्या मिळवा की आणि गुपित आणि नंतर डेमो वापरा आत समाविष्ट. मग पहा पर्ल साठी एपीआय द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

#!/usr/bin/perl

use GrabzItClient;

$grabzIt = GrabzItClient->new("Sign in to view your Application Key", "Sign in to view your Application Secret");
$grabzIt->URLToRenderedHTML("https://www.bbc.com/");
$grabzIt->SaveTo("result.html");

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ता GrabzItHTMLOptions वर्ग इतर रूपांतरण पद्धती प्रमाणेच.

खाली दिलेला उदाहरण कोड दर्शवितो की पीएचपीचा वापर करुन यूआरएलचे URL मध्ये रूपांतरित करणे किती सोपे आहे. प्रस्तुत केवळ HTML तयार करणे प्रारंभ करण्यासाठी पीएचपी लायब्ररी डाउनलोड करा, आपल्या मिळवा की आणि गुपित आणि नंतर डेमो वापरा आत समाविष्ट. मग पहा पीएचपीसाठी एपीआय द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

include("GrabzItClient.php");

$grabzIt = new \GrabzIt\G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ret");
$grabzIt->URLToRenderedHTML("https://www.bbc.com/"); 
$grabzIt->SaveTo("result.html");

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ता GrabzItHTMLOptions वर्ग इतर रूपांतरण पद्धती प्रमाणेच.

पायथनचा वापर करून URL ला HTML मध्ये रूपांतरित करण्यासाठी आमचे API वापरणे किती सोपे आहे हे खालील उदाहरण कोड दर्शविते. प्रस्तुत केवळ HTML तयार करणे प्रारंभ करण्यासाठी पायथन ग्रंथालय डाउनलोड करा, आपल्या मिळवा की आणि गुपित आणि नंतर डेमो वापरा आत समाविष्ट. मग पहा पायथनसाठी API द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

from GrabzIt import GrabzItClient

grabzIt = GrabzItClient.GrabzItClient("Sign in to view your Application Key", "Sign in to view your Application Secret")
grabzIt.URLToRenderedHTML("https://www.bbc.com/") 
grabzIt.SaveTo("result.html") 

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ता GrabzItHTMLOptions वर्ग इतर रूपांतरण पद्धती प्रमाणेच.

URL चे प्रस्तुत केलेल्या HTML मध्ये रूपांतरित करण्यासाठी आमचे RESTful API वापरणे किती सोपे आहे हे खालील उदाहरण कोड दर्शविते.

https://api.grabz.it/services/convert.ashx?key=Sign in to view your Application Key&format=html&url=https%3A%2F%2Fwww.bbc.com%2F

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ता paramateres इतर रूपांतरण पद्धती प्रमाणेच.

खाली उदाहरण कोड दर्शवितो की रुबीचा वापर करुन URL ला HTML मध्ये रुपांतरित करण्यासाठी आमचे API वापरणे किती सोपे आहे. प्रस्तुत केवळ HTML तयार करणे प्रारंभ करण्यासाठी रुबी रत्न डाउनलोड करा, आपल्या मिळवा की आणि गुपित आणि नंतर डेमो वापरा आत समाविष्ट. मग पहा रुबीसाठी एपीआय दस्तऐवजीकरण आपण GrabzIt चे API वापरू शकता असे सर्व मार्ग शोधण्यासाठी.

require 'grabzit'

grabzItClient = GrabzIt::Client.new("Sign in to view your Application Key", "Sign in to view your Application Secret")
grabzItClient.url_to_rendered_html("https://www.bbc.com/")	
grabzItClient.save_to("result.html")  	

आपण अर्थातच HTML रेंडरिंग सानुकूलित करू शकता HTMLOptions वर्ग इतर रूपांतरण पद्धती प्रमाणेच.